首页技术excel函数index用法 excel数据自动引入另一个表

excel函数index用法 excel数据自动引入另一个表

编程之家2026-05-22727次浏览

大家好,如果您还对excel函数index用法不太了解,没有关系,今天就由本站为大家分享excel函数index用法的知识,包括excel数据自动引入另一个表的问题都会给大家分析到,还望可以解决大家的问题,下面我们就开始吧!

excel函数index用法 excel数据自动引入另一个表

关于excel函数中index的用法

index函数:用于返回表格或区域中的数值或对数值的引用。

主要2种形式:

数组:index(数组区域,N号,列号)

引用:index(单元格区域的引用,行数,列数,从第几个选择区域内引用)

示例

INDEX用于返回表格或区域中的数值或对数值的引用。

excel函数index用法 excel数据自动引入另一个表

函数 INDEX()有两种形式:数组和引用。数组形式通常返回数值或数值数组;引用形式通常返回引用。

(1)INDEX(array,row_num,column_num)返回数组中指定单元格或单元格数组的数值。

Array为单元格区域或数组常数。Row_num为数组中某行的行序号,函数从该行返回数值。Column_num为数组中某列的列序号,函数从该列返回数值。需注意的是Row_num和 column_num必须指向 array中的某一单元格,否则,函数 INDEX返回错误值#REF!。

(2)INDEX(reference,row_num,column_num,area_num)返回引用中指定单元格或单元格区域的引用。

Reference为对一个或多个单元格区域的引用。

Row_num为引用中某行的行序号,函数从该行返回一个引用。

excel函数index用法 excel数据自动引入另一个表

Column_num为引用中某列的列序号,函数从该列返回一个引用。

需注意的是Row_num、column_num和 area_num必须指向 reference中的单元格;否则,函数 INDEX返回错误值#REF!。如果省略 row_num和 column_num,函数 INDEX返回由 area_num所指定的区域。

Excel函数学习之查找函数INDEX()的使用方法

INDEX函数是Excel中用于在指定单元格区域返回特定行列交叉处单元格值或引用的查找函数,其使用方法及实战技巧如下:

一、基础语法与核心逻辑

INDEX函数的标准结构为INDEX(单元格区域,行号,列号),通过坐标定位返回目标值。例如,公式=INDEX(B2:G11,4,3)可返回区域B2:G11中第4行第3列的单元格值“囡”。若区域为单行或单列,仅需指定一个坐标值:

单列提取:如=INDEX(A17:A21,2)返回A17:A21中第2行的值“李惠”;单行提取:如=INDEX(A18:D18,4)返回A18:D18中第4列的值“基本工资”。二、与辅助函数组团实现半自动查找

当数据量较大时,人工查找坐标效率低下,需结合COLUMN、ROW函数实现规律性取值:

与COLUMN组团:通过COLUMN(B1)生成连续列号,实现同行多数据提取。例如,公式=INDEX($A17:$E21,3,COLUMN(B1))右拉填充可连续返回第3行中第2、3、4列的值(姓名、年龄、入职时间)。与ROW组团:通过ROW(A3)生成连续行号,实现同列多数据提取。例如,公式=INDEX(A$17:E$21,ROW(A3),2)下拉填充可返回第2列中第3、4、5行的值(多个工号对应的姓名)。行列同时组团:结合COLUMN和ROW实现复杂规律取值。例如,公式=INDEX($A$17:$E$21,ROW(A1)*2-1,COLUMN(A1)*2)右拉下拉填充可隔行隔列提取数据(如工号C15、C23、C10的姓名和入职时间)。三、与MATCH函数组团实现全自动查找

当数据规律复杂或无规律时,需借助MATCH函数自动定位行列坐标,彻底摆脱人工干预:

基础用法:公式=INDEX($A$17:$E$21,MATCH($B28,$A$17:$A$21,0),MATCH(C$27,$A$16:$E$16,0))通过MATCH分别查找行、列位置,实现跨区域条件匹配。与VLOOKUP的对比:正向查找:VLOOKUP+MATCH公式更简洁(如=VLOOKUP($B28,$A$17:$E$21,MATCH(C$27,$A$16:$E$16,0),0));

反向查找:INDEX+MATCH无需重构查找区域,公式更优(如=INDEX(A$17:B$21,MATCH(G17,B$17:B$21,0),1))。

四、与SMALL、IF组团实现一对多查找

通过嵌套SMALL和IF函数,INDEX可处理一对多匹配场景(如提取同一部门所有员工信息)。公式示例:

=IFERROR(INDEX($A$2:$D$21,SMALL(IF($C$2:$C$21=$F$2,ROW($1:$20),99),ROW(A1)),MATCH(F$3,$A$1:$D$1,0)),"")

该公式通过IF筛选符合条件的数据行,SMALL按顺序提取行号,最终返回匹配结果,被称为“万金油公式”。

总结:INDEX函数的核心优势在于精确坐标定位,但需依赖辅助函数实现自动化。其与MATCH、COLUMN、ROW等函数的组合可覆盖从简单到复杂的各类查找需求,尤其在反向查找和一对多场景中表现突出。掌握这些技巧后,可显著提升数据处理效率。

excel中的index函数如何使用

INDEX用于返回表格或区域中的数值或对数值的引用。

函数 INDEX()有两种形式:数组和引用。数组形式通常返回数值或数值数组;引用形式通常返回引用。

(1)INDEX(array,row_num,column_num)返回数组中指定单元格或单元格数组的数值。

Array为单元格区域或数组常数。Row_num为数组中某行的行序号,函数从该行返回数值。Column_num为数组中某列的列序号,函数从该列返回数值。需注意的是Row_num和 column_num必须指向 array中的某一单元格,否则,函数 INDEX返回错误值#REF!。

(2)INDEX(reference,row_num,column_num,area_num)返回引用中指定单元格或单元格区域的引用。

Reference为对一个或多个单元格区域的引用。

Row_num为引用中某行的行序号,函数从该行返回一个引用。

Column_num为引用中某列的列序号,函数从该列返回一个引用。

需注意的是Row_num、column_num和 area_num必须指向 reference中的单元格;否则,函数 INDEX返回错误值#REF!。如果省略 row_num和 column_num,函数 INDEX返回由 area_num所指定的区域。

希望能够帮到你,请采纳。

如果你还想了解更多这方面的信息,记得收藏关注本站。

完整的网页代码模板 网页设计制作网站模板html中button按钮属性(button在html里有什么作用)